Improve wishlist and watchlist auto-scheduling robustness
Refactored wishlist and watchlist auto-processing scheduling to use atomic timer updates and retry logic, preventing stuck timers and improving reliability. Removed excessive debug logging and improved error handling throughout related functions. Added checks to prevent concurrent wishlist processing and ensured timer state is managed consistently.
